I have received a letter from the ATO saying I may have 'forgotten to include rental income in (my) tax return'. I no longer have legal ownership of this property and I'm wondering how I can update my ATO profile to reflect this. The contact details loosely provided on the letter have not been helpful and don't seem to get me in touch with someone who can update my record. Can anyone help?
Hi @cupnoodle
Yes, if you speak with our individual's area, they'll gather info from you and take it from there.
The letters were based on data from property managers, so you can just let us know you don't own the property anymore or didn't own it for the years mentioned in the letter.
